What is it called when you pose for art?
What it is called when you pose for art varies. If you've paid to have an artist produce a portrait of you, the act of posing for them is sometimes referred to as sitting or sitting for a portrait. When someone poses so that artists can create sketches or practice in a classroom-type setting, the term used to describe it is usually art modeling.
